## Handover: Inkline undo/redo

Undo/redo in the Inkline diagram editor uses a command-stack service, not local state. Stack depth, snapshot interval, and merge window are all server-configured — don't hardcode them. Known issue: redo clears on reconnect (ticket open). The service currently runs with these settings:

deployment values, kajep-kageg:
[praix]
host = praix.paliqcorp.corp
user = praix_svc
database = praix_prod

## Step 4: Nightly search reindex

After merging the schema change, the Wrenfield nightly reindex must be updated to read from the new documents_v2 table. The old table stays in place for one release as a fallback. Reviewers should confirm the reindex job drops and rebuilds aliases atomically — a partial swap leaves stale results visible for hours. Runtime is roughly 40 minutes at current volume. The job reads the following configuration values at launch.

service settings:
[silwyn]
host = silwyn.crelvogrid.internal
user = silwyn_svc
database = silwyn_prod

## Ownership

All cron jobs formerly scheduled on the Kestrel batch hosts have been migrated to the Ottervale workflow engine. No ad-hoc crontabs remain; any found during review should be flagged as violations. Workflow definitions live in `workflows/` and are deployed only via the signed pipeline. Secrets are injected at runtime, never stored in job specs. For audit access, scope approvals, or questions about residual permissions, contact the owner identified below.

account owner for bawip-tahag: Raleth Quenok